Song Premiere: Ben Sollee - "Unfinished"
Dynamic Kentucky-born cellist and songwriter Ben Sollee will be releasing a new full-length album, Half-Made Man, on Sept. 25. The record, Sollee’s fourth studio album, will be released on his own label, Tin Ear Records.
“Half-Made Man is a collection of self-portraits that were performed, for the most part, live to tape—there was much less scrutinizing for perfection,” Sollee said about his new album. “We steered our ears towards getting the right energy for each song.”
The “we” that Sollee refers to includes an impressive cast of musicians—such as My Morning Jacket guitarist Carl Broemel and STS9 bassist Alana Rocklin—that he brought into the Louisville, Ky., studio where he recorded and self-produced the album.
“I dug deep into myself and asked the musicians to go there with me,” he comments. “It won’t be easy to place this album in one category, but I, and my generation, are measured by a little bit of everything these days.”
